One of the primary determinants of quartz countertop pricing is the quality and source of the quartz itself, as high-grade quartz is harvested for uniformity in color and structure, ensuring durability and aesthetic appeal. Lower-grade alternatives may reduce upfront costs but could compromise long-term durability or uniformity. The production process, including precise blending and polishing, affects the final cost, especially for unique patterns or premium finishes, allowing homeowners to balance quality against price effectively.
Customization further impacts the quartz counter top price, with options like edge profiles, integrated sinks, and backsplashes adding unique value. Edges with specialized shapes or integrated design elements demand extra labor, reflecting in higher costs. Adding coordinated quartz panels or continuous surfaces elevates the aesthetic while slightly raising costs. Selecting reputable fabricators ensures that complex designs are flawlessly executed, preserving both beauty and functionality. The expertise of professional installers directly impacts overall pricing and performance. Correct installation techniques prevent damage and maintain surface integrity over time. Installation charges fluctuate with project size, access difficulty, and intricate configurations. While DIY installation may appear cost-saving, risks often outweigh the benefits, particularly with premium quartz.

The scale and complexity of a project influence material and labor expenditures. Larger surfaces require more material and extended labor, naturally increasing expenses. Design intricacies like corners, cutouts, or multi-level surfaces contribute to higher installation charges.
